a10dc8fcSyntax highlighting feature
Though styles are almost nothing. It's too early to add styles.
I considered - actually researched almost a day - tree-sitter for highlighting.
However, the state of the ecosystem is not ready to use for web/WASM environment.
* Some parsers use unexported C-API, which causes runtime panic.
* Markdown parser requires block parsing -> inline parsing per blocks.
* Generated parsers are large in general (e.g. TSX = ~3MB in WASM,
~5MB in `Uint8Array(JSON.parse("[0,...]"))` form).
* Parser alone is barely usable: query, especially tailor made highlight query is
needed for **each parsers**. (most of the parser I saw have "highlight.scm" but
it seems to be for reference)
While refractor requires additional tree-traversal for removing too generic
classes, I believe this is way too efficient and reliable compare to tree-sitter
(and its ecosystem) in its current state.

4ad002ffUse separate GitHub Actions cache for each workflow
Deno does not download every modules listed in the lockfile.
Instead, it lazily downloads imported file: thus, the contents of
`$DENO_DIR` depends on "what module Deno loaded". Since workflows
run different entrypoints (deploy=docs/build.ts, test=test files),
only one of workflow benefit from cache and others could face a
lot of cache misses.

66b67ed0Simplify content parsing / metadata generation
- Remove Metadata Parser
- Tree Builder now is also responsible for generating document metadata
- Content Parser now can return document metadata
The major factor motivating this refactor is the last bullet point.
I wrote Metadata Parser with YAML frontmatter parsing...but that is definetely
out of scope. What if one want to use HTML as a document and use `<title>`
element? What if one want to use JPEG as a document and use EXIF for title and
name? At all, metadata derived by content requires content parsing, thus Content
Parser returns document metadata.
Behaviors and options existed in VaultParser (Metadata Parser) and Tree Parser
are re-implemented as a more flexible plugin, TreeBuildStrategy. I noticed
those options are, in the end, `map` and `filter`. This design maintains both
customizability and ease-of-use.
Maybe the TreeBuildStrategy should be more generic so it's defined in the generic
Tree Builder interface side (`tree_builder/interface.ts`). But I kept this form
as I don't feel necessity for now. Maybe change later.

cf7e93b6Removed locale assumptions
This is better than assuming top-level directories as a locale or entire Vault consists of
single locale. Large part is flexibility: one can choose between `<lang>/<..contents..>` structure
and `<..contents..>/<lang>` structure. In addition to the flexibility, directory name can be more
human friendly, such as "English" rather than "en".
This change eliminates the complexity of handling default language not having path prefix.
Thanks to this simplification, I can focus on path/name handling more.
The last notable change is replace of "locale" to "lang". I initially thought locale would be
appropriate as it also covers formatting. However, as the output of this program is (mostly)
public viewable website, the content SHOULD NOT specify which locale to use. Instead, UA is
responsible for deciding which locale to use for formatting.

c3d0fbb7Simplify architecture further
The "Asset" thing existed because initially both Tree Builder and Page Builder
produced assets. However, because of architecture changes I did earlier, Tree
Builder no longer produces assets. That change and this change increase the scope
of Page Builder massively, but I believe this is far better abstract compared to
the previous ones.
For instance, if I were to create an Asset Plugin for CSS postprocessing, what
I/F needed for that? Even with this simple case, the I/F would be messy because
a number of the resulting artifacts could be larger than the input, such as when
the source CSS file imports other files. And, more (probably) important plugin,
is image optimisation. However, that task requires caller (= Page Builder) to
know the result in advance: e.g. a plugin generates WebP and Avif from JPEG file
and optimises the JPEG file but Page Builder can't use the former two because
it needs to know the plugin produces those files and modify `<img>` tag to
`<picture>` tag with corresponding `<source>` tags and `<img>` tag. Considering
these, I concluded the "Asset Manager" and "Asset Plugin" system are useless at most.
Again, this make Page Builder more fat. But what kind of website assets are needed
and how to generate those are differs by websites, at all. Page Builder need to be fat.
